Materialised has brought innovative, high performance furnishing textiles, wall covering, acoustics and art to the Australasian contract interior design industry since 1980. Our speciality is *whole room solutions* with products specifically designed for high demand environments such as healthcare, hospitality, hotel, aged care, hospital, wellness, office, education and commercial industries. Flame retardancy, high abrasion resistance and acoustic absorption are key. Our product range enables the complete furnishing requirement… Block-out drapery, sheers, waterproof upholstery, faux leather, framed art, luxury bedspreads, acoustic panelling and wall covering of all kinds. Beyond innovative product, we act as a conduit to our clients for information on trends and changes in regulations affecting our industry, garnered from our decades of strong relationship with industry leaders worldwide. Manufacturing and warehousing takes place in the Southern Sydney suburb of Blakehurst. Dye sublimation printing allows us to offer custom design solutions without compromising on quality or performance. What some would call showrooms, we describe as Design Studios. These are located in the major centres across Australia and New Zealand, Adelaide, Auckland, Brisbane, Melbourne, Perth and Sydney. A socially responsible company, we are committed to *making a difference* in our community and our industry. This dedication is evidenced by our support of local charities, our green policy and ‘Fabrics for the Real World’ training program, which is highly regarded by universities and design schools. Walmajarri Aboriginal artist, Jimmy Pike (1940-2002) was born east of Japingka, in the Kimberley region of Western Australia. Taking flora and fauna inspiration unique to his Australian desert life, he utilised whatever medium he needed to express his stories in his art, and not necessarily traditional ones. Having been sent photos and scans of Jimmy’s artwork, our Materialised designers translated his art into repeatable prints for contemporary textile and wall coverings. Unravelling the magic of performance boucle! Bouclé, a French word meaning “curled” or “looped,” refers to a type of yarn characterised by its looped or curled appearance. With advancements in textile technology, modern bouclé fabrics can be crafted from a variety of materials, including synthetic fibres and blends.
